API Intermediates: The Essential Building Blocks of Modern Medicines!


Ever wondered how life-saving medicines are made before they reach the pharmacy?

API intermediates play a crucial role in pharmaceutical manufacturing by serving as key compounds in the production of Active Pharmaceutical Ingredients (APIs).

📖 History / Origin

The concept of API (Active Pharmaceutical Ingredient) intermediates evolved alongside the growth of the pharmaceutical industry in the 20th century. As drug manufacturing became more advanced, manufacturers began producing intermediate compounds through carefully controlled chemical or biotechnological processes. Today, API intermediates are an integral part of the global pharmaceutical supply chain, supporting the production of safe, effective, and high-quality medicines.

🧪 Types of API Intermediates

  • Chemical API Intermediates

  • Synthetic Organic Intermediates

  • Biotech/Fermentation-Based Intermediates

  • Chiral Intermediates

  • Peptide Intermediates

  • Custom API Intermediates for Specialized Drug Development

⚙️ Materials / Key Features

API intermediates are characterized by:

  • High-purity chemical or biological compounds

  • Produced through multi-step synthesis or fermentation processes

  • Manufactured under strict quality control standards

  • Carefully tested for identity, purity, and consistency

  • Essential precursors used to produce Active Pharmaceutical Ingredients (APIs)

  • Designed to meet regulatory and industry quality requirements
